Here's where they could start:


NEW YORK (CNNMoney.com) -- Goldman Sachs Chairman and CEO Lloyd Blankfein will take home nearly $68 million in restricted stock, options and cash, making it the largest bonus ever given to a Wall Street CEO.

Blankfein was awarded $26.8 million in cash and $41.1 million in restricted stock and stock options, according to a company fil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ission issued Friday.

Lehman Brothers chairman and CEO Richard Fuld Jr. made $34 million in 2007.


Goldman Sachs paid Co-Chief Operating Officers Gary Cohn and Jon Winkereid made $72.5 million and $71 million.


American International Group’s chief executive Martin Sullivan, who was ousted in June, made $14 million.

Morgan Stanley Chief Financial Officer Colin Kelleher got $21 million.

Merrill Lynch CEO John Thain was paid $17 million in salary, bonuses and stock options.

JP Morgan Chase & Co. chairman and CEO James Dimon earned $28 million in 2007. Chase bought Bear Stearns in a fire sale earlier this year with Washington promising to take on up to $30 billion in assets to get the deal done.

Fannie Mae CEO Daniel Mudd made $11.6 million in 2007.

Freddie Mac, CEO Richard Syron, brought in $18 million.


Wachovia Corp. chairman and CEO G. Kennedy Thompson received $21 million in 2007. He was succeeded by Robert Steel as CEO in July. Steel is slated to get a $1 million salary with an opportunity for a $12 million bonus, according to CEO Watch.

Seattle-based Washington Mutual will pay its new CEO Alan Fishman a salary and incentive package worth more than $20 million through 2009 for taking the helm of the battered bank, according to the Puget Sound Business Journal.

I might be showing how far behind the times I am here, but I came across a story recently, which might make you think about right and wrong online.

Some of you might know Craig's List. It's an internet bulletin board started in San Francisco and is now available all over the world.

In 2006, a couple of jokers in Seattle posted at ad posing as a submissive female looking for a dominant male to defile her. The aim was to see how many responses they could get in 24 hours.

They got 178 replies and 145 photos.

People sent email addresses from home and work, phone numbers as well as their real names in some cases.

Next they posted all the replies on a wiki-satire site called Encyclopaedia Dramatica, with the goal of getting people to identify the respondents in real life.

The ethical debate has been raging ever since. The story was picked up by various news outlets including the BBC.

Murder in Kaohsiung!

This has been the talk of the town.


We played poker with the two suspects.

Here's the story from The Taipei Times:

American, Filipina arrested over body in garbage bag

SUSPECTS IN CUSTODY: David Fillion and his girlfriend Armia were arrested at a private language school in Tsoying. The pair denied being involved in the murder
By Rich Chang
STAFF REPORTER, WITH CNA AND DPA
Wednesday, Sep 19, 2007, Page 1

Kaohsiung police on Monday night arrested a US citizen and his Filipina girlfriend on suspicion of murder after a woman's body was found in a garbage bag in front of a store in the city's Yencheng District (鹽埕) on Saturday evening.

Police said the two suspects -- US citizen David Fillion and his Filipina girlfriend Armia -- deny any involvement in the murder.

Police on Sunday named the deceased as 48-year-old Chou Mei-yun (邱美雲), a broker who helped foreigners find work teaching languages at private schools.

Chou left home last Wednesday afternoon, telling her son she would not be home for supper. She was never seen again.

Police said footage from a surveillance camera near the place where the body was found showed a woman riding a scooter towing a big black garbage bag on Friday at approximately 11pm.

The bag was carried on a two-wheeled trailer tied to the rear of the scooter, police said.

Police on Monday traced the scooter to its owner, a Japanese teacher who told the police that she had lent the scooter to Fillion on Friday and that he had not returned it.

Police then went to Fillion's residence in the city's Tsoying District (左營), but discovered that Fillion and Armia had moved out.

Investigators said they found traces of blood and dog hair in the apartment.

They had also found dog hair in the plastic bag which held Chiu's body.

A DNA test showed that the blood found at Fillion's apartment matched that of the deceased, the Kaohsiung City police said last night.

Police discovered that Fillion had gone to stay with a friend in the city's Linya District (苓雅) on Thursday.

Police officers visited the residence and were told by the friend, surnamed Lee, that Fillion had borrowed a trailer from him on Friday.

Fillion and Armia were arrested at a private language school in Tsoying, where Fillion worked, late on Monday.

The pair denied any involvement in the murder.

They were accompanied by several officials from the American Institute in Taiwan's Kaohsiung Office and had refused to answer questions overnight, the police said.

Kaohsiung District Prosecutors' Office spokesman Chung Chung-hsiao (鍾忠孝) yesterday told reporters that prosecutors had been able to question the two suspects yesterday afternoon, and they had asked the police to gather more evidence in support of their case.

Police said they were investigating whether Chou had had any financial disputes with Fillion.

They said they suspect the woman who abandoned the body was Armia and not a Japanese woman as originally thought.

Police said the victim had been tied up with nylon ropes and had multiple stab wounds to her chest and thigh, as well as marks on her neck that suggested possible strangulation.

Police suspect the murder was not committed by a single person.
